# react-search-highlight
react-search-highlight is a light weight react package to highlight static/dynamic search for auto completion
![]()
![]()
![]()
## Installation
install it using npm or yarn to include it in your own React project
You will also need to import css modules in root your project before using it. `dist/react-search-highlight.cjs.development.css`
```bash
npm install react-search-highlight
```or:
```bash
yarn add react-search-highlight
```## Usage

```#### Data must be provided as array of object format in `` component `data` prop, additionally `keysToSearch` prop must be a array of keys to search form data object.
```tsx
const data = [
{
title:....,
name:.....,
age:......,
},
....
]
// It is not necessary to pass all the keys from the object, only keys that are passed
// will be searched
const keysToSearch = ['title','name']```
## 🔨 API
`useReactSearchHighlight` can be used with `ReactSearchHighlightProvider` and it can be used throughout the component to access the context values. Note that whenever you are using it you must wrap the entire component using `ReactSearchHighlightProvider`.```tsx static
const {
suggestions,
isLoading,
input,
startLoading,
endLoading,
isResultsEmpty,
resetState
} = useReactSearchHighlight();
```You can also access these values using wrapper component

```### `` Props:
```tsx
// Data to perform search operation
data: any[];// Determines which keys to search from the data object
keysToSearch?: string[];// Determines input box behaviour it accepts three values DEBOUNCE, THROTTLE or DEFAULT
inputAlgorithm?: typeof DEBOUNCE | typeof THROTTLE | typeof DEFAULT;// Optional: Determines the input algorithm timeout for debounce and throttle
inputAlgorithmTimeout?: number;// Determines matching algorithm to search over data, it accepts two values CHARACTER_MATCHING or STRING_MATCHING
// CHARACTER_MATCHING matches each character from the data to highlight it
// STRING_MATCHING matches each word from the data to highlight it
matchingAlgorithm?: typeof CHARACTER_MATCHING | typeof STRING_MATCHING;// Optional: input value, it is recommended not to pass any in general case
value?: string;// Optional: input value onChange event handler
onChange?: (e:React.ChangeEvent) => void// Optional: Determines initial input value
initialValue?: string// Optional: It can be used to change search bar icon
PrefixIcon?: React.FC
